What's Happening?
Tyran Stokes, a top-ranked basketball recruit, is set to announce his college decision, choosing between Kentucky and Kansas. The decision will be revealed on 'Inside the NBA' on ESPN. Both schools have been actively pursuing Stokes, with Kentucky's Mark
Pope and Kansas' Bill Self leading the recruitment efforts. The recruitment process has been marked by speculation and strategic moves, with Nike's influence being a significant factor due to its sponsorship ties with both schools. The decision is highly anticipated, as Stokes is considered a major asset for any college basketball program.
